辽东—吉南地区硼矿床地质特征及成矿规律

摘    要:辽东—吉南地区硼矿床产于早元古代辽东裂谷中,有硼镁石、含磁铁矿-硼镁石和磁铁矿-硼镁石3种矿床类型,分别赋存于下元古界宽甸群砖庙组下段、老营沟组中段和高小岭组下段,形成3个含硼原始沉积旋回,具严格的层控特点。裂谷阶段沉积的矿源层硼组分,溶于吕粱运动的区域变质和混合岩化的变质热液中,并在该时期的东西向褶皱层间剪切作用控制下,顺层侵位于褶皱翼部低压空间和轴部虚脱部位。成矿后构造对矿床具一定的改造作用,从而形成多成因多期次的沉积变质再造硼矿床。

GEOLOGY AND MINERALIZATION OF BORON DEPOSITS ACROSS EAST OF LIAONING AND SOUTH OF JILIN REGION
Abstract:Boron mineralizations along the Liaodong rift across the east of Liaoning andsouth of Jilin region yielded three deposit types:ascharite,magnetite-hearing aschariteand magnetite-ascharite.These three types represent three different horon-containingsedimentary cycles and developed at the lower Zhuanmiao series of the KuandianGrorp(lower Proterozaic),the middle Laoyinggou series and the lower Gaoxiaolingseries,respectively.Mineralization modle suggested for these deposit point out thatboron hearing materials of the rift sediments first incarparated into meta-hypothermalfluids associated with regional metamarphism and migmatization during the Lüliangmovement and then,govrned by shear forces divided from EW-trending folding atthat time,passed along straitigraphic planes into low presure zones along the flanks ofthe folds and into collapsed places at the area,to finally precipitate down.Post-mineralization tectonics put a strongly deformation on the regional bodies and gavethem polygenetic and polycyclic characters.In this way,came such boron deposits astypical of first sedimentation then metamarphism,then deformation.
